JUDGMENT :- This is a defendants appeal against the judgment and decree declaring Respondent Nos. 1 and 2 the owners and No. 3 their lessee in respect of the suit property and restraining the appellants from interfering with their possession. The judgment is so brief and laconic that it is difficult to make out the respective pleadings of the parties. As I am remanding the case to the learned lower Court, it is not necessary to set out the pleadings in detail.

2. The dispute relates to a property called Rumod situate at Surla. The registration number of the property is said to be 12.104. Respondents did not raise specific pleadings about their title though in evidence attempt was made to induct material facts about title which were not at all pleaded. Respondents 1 and 2 started with a bland plea that they were the owners and they had leased out the property to Respondent No. 3. 3. Appellants/defendants denied Respondents title and pleaded ownership and possession with them. The main point raised by the appellants was that actually the registration number of the property Rumod was 8523 and not 12104 as pleaded in the plaint.
